Russia closes window for dissent as Ukraine’s attacks stir public dismay


The Kremlin has initiated a new crackdown on anti-war voices ahead of Russia’s parliamentary elections in September, barring candidates from running if they show any sign of opposing the bloody, expensive and increasingly unpopular military operation in Ukraine.
